Energy is essential for modern human life, yet conventional energy sources are depleting rapidly. This paper introduces an innovative method for generating electrical power using speed breakers, converting the kinetic energy from vehicles into mechanical energy, and then to electrical energy through a rack-and-pinion mechanism. The generated power can be stored and used for street lighting and other applications. This sustainable approach offers a clean, low-cost, and efficient solution for small-scale power generation, especially in urban areas with significant traffic. The study explores the system's design, methodology, advantages, and performance in different traffic conditions.
